Elara's POV

After I said those words, the bedroom fell silent.

Damien stared at me. His face went through several expressions.

Confusion. Disbelief.

Then something that might have been panic.

"Let you go?" he repeated slowly.

"Yes."

"I don't want to let you go."

The words should have meant something. Once upon a time, they would have meant everything to me.

Now they felt empty.

"What you want doesn't matter anymore," I said quietly.

"It does matter." He stepped closer. "We matter. Our marriage matters."

I almost laughed at the irony. After six years of treating our marriage like a burden, now he wanted to claim it mattered.

"Isabella is back now," he continued. His voice grew more confident. "I can finally make things right with her. Give her proper compensation for all the years she lost because of our forced marriage."

Even in his attempt to save our marriage, Isabella came first.
